## Configuration — Replica Lag Alarm

The Tessergate lag alarm watches each read replica and pages support when replication delay exceeds the configured threshold. All settings live in lagwatch.env. Set the primary host, the polling interval (default 15 seconds), and the lag threshold in milliseconds; values below 500 produce noisy pages and should be avoided. The alarm also needs credentials to query replica status, entered on the line just below the threshold.

vault entry, yahif-yajep: COURIER_KEY29=b802bdf8034096b65a51c6ba5abe2

Ticket: Staging env misconfigured for Siftgate bloom filter

The bloom layer in front of the Pellet KV store is rejecting all lookups in staging because the env file was copied from the dev template without credentials. False-positive tuning values are fine; only the auth line is missing. To unblock the weekly demo, the Pellet admission secret must be set on the following line.

env line for yaguf-fajop: LEDGER_TOKEN13=fb08984397349

## Artifact signing — Papertrace invoice renderer

All builds of the Papertrace PDF invoice renderer are signed at the end of the CI pipeline. The verifier checks both the binary and the embedded font bundle; unsigned artifacts are rejected at deploy. Rotation happens quarterly, with old keys revoked within 48 hours. For verification during review, the current artifact signing key is provided below.

deploy key for kahof-tadup: bky4_rRMZ

**Q: How do I request a gradual rollout in Plumeline?**

Plumeline, our feature-flag rollout framework, supports percentage-based rollouts configured through the flag manifest. New team members should start with the sandbox environment before touching production flags, and every production rollout requires a reviewer from the owning service. If the documentation leaves your question unanswered, or you need rollout approval expedited, contact the Plumeline maintainers at the address below.

billing contact of yawip-yadup = druath.casdor@nelvrolabs.internal